Knowing the Importance of an Established Routine

  • Routine: a regular course of procedure

  • Habit: a behavior pattern acquired by frequent repetition or physiologic exposure that shows itself in regularity or increased facility of performance

  • Schedule: procedural plan that indicates the time and sequence of each operation

  • Organization: to arrange by systematic planning and united effort

WHY ARE ROUTINES SO IMPORTANT?

Let’s Learn Together

  • Routines are the foundation for the creation of habits.

  • Having a consistent routine at similar times creates habits.

  • When good time manage habits are created it helps people organize their lives.

  • Routine elements in one’s life should include: times of meals, sleep, extracurricular activities, etc.

  • This is done with the use of organization.

  • One becomes organized by consistently being detail oriented.

  •  Examples: Color coding each task (homework, practice, tests, games, social events, etc.)
